What does "primitive" mean?

  1. adj Belonging to an early stage of development; basic or unrefined.
    "They lived in primitive conditions with no running water."
  2. noun (computing) A basic data type or simple building block from which more complex structures are made.
    "Integers and booleans are examples of primitives in most programming languages."
